AME won't open: dvacore.dll?
Hi,
I have been having problems with Premiere Pro CS4 since I got it. The program itself has been fine, but I have had difficulty exporting my projects successfully. Originally, each project would fail while queued in AME, now, its worse. When I try to open AME through PPro, nothing happens. When I try to open AME seperately, I get the following error:
Adobe Media Encoder.exe - Entry Point Not Found
The procedure entry point ??0NewHandlerInitializer@ErrorManager@config@dvacore@@QAE@XZ could not be located in the dynamic library dvacore.dll
This means nothing to me, would not even know where to begin...
I have tried uninstalling and reinstalling PPro (numerous times), I have done all of the things that I have seen advised on forums, but nothing seems to work. Any help? I've got a deadline that I don't want to miss just because of this!

Inappropriate?I seem to have solved it. If anyone else has this problem, heres what I did:
Simply copy dvacore.dll from Premiere Pro CS4 (C:\Program Files\Adobe\Adobe Premiere Pro CS4) and paste it into C:\Program Files\Adobe\Adobe Media Encoder CS4
Also, make sure to make a backup of the original dll file, in case it doesnt work for you.
